The Villages of Rosemont provides assisted living and memory care in Virginia Beach, VA. Assisted living offers help with daily tasks such as dressing, bathing, and medication while a resident keeps their own apartment, while memory care provides a secured setting with supervision for someone at risk of wandering.
Because both care levels are available in one community, The Villages of Rosemont may be a good fit for a resident whose care needs may grow over time without requiring a move to another community. The community is in the Windsor Woods neighborhood. It has 80 beds and a 74% occupancy rate, meaning 74% of its beds are occupied. Steve De Jesus serves as administrator. A Walk Score of 34 out of 100 places the area in a car-dependent setting, so most errands require a car or a ride and a resident who no longer drives would need transportation for them.
